ACCESS 更新クエリの使い方(他のテーブルを用いた更新含む)

access e69bb4e696b0e382afe382a8e383aae381aee4bdbfe38184e696b9efbc88e4bb96e381aee38386e383bce38396e383abe38292e794a8e38184e3819fe69bb4

ACCESSの更新クエリは、テーブルのデータを一括更新する際に非常に便利な機能です。特定の条件に基づいてデータを更新したり、他のテーブルのデータを参照して更新したりすることができます。本記事では、更新クエリの基本的な使い方から、他のテーブルを用いた更新方法まで、具体的な手順を交えて詳しく解説します。ACCESS初心者の方でも理解しやすいように、実用的な例を挙げて説明していきますので、ぜひ参考にしてください。更新クエリをマスターして、データベース管理をより効率化しましょう。

ACCESS 更新クエリの基本的な使い方

ACCESS 更新クエリは、データベース内のデータを更新するための強力なツールです。このクエリを使用することで、大量のデータを効率的に更新できます。更新クエリの基本的な使い方は、更新したいテーブルを選択し、更新するフィールドを指定することです。

更新クエリの作成方法

更新クエリを作成するには、まずクエリデザイナを開きます。次に、更新したいテーブルを追加し、更新するフィールドを指定します。更新クエリでは、更新先 と 更新元 を指定する必要があります。更新先は、更新したいフィールドであり、更新元は、更新する値です。 更新クエリの作成手順は以下の通りです。

  1. クエリデザイナ を開きます。
  2. 更新したい テーブル を追加します。
  3. 更新する フィールド を指定します。

他のテーブルを用いた更新クエリの使い方

他のテーブルを用いた更新クエリを使用することで、複数のテーブル間でデータを同期させることができます。たとえば、顧客テーブル と 注文テーブル があり、顧客テーブルの住所を更新した場合、注文テーブルの住所も更新することができます。 他のテーブルを用いた更新クエリの作成手順は以下の通りです。

  1. クエリデザイナ を開きます。
  2. 更新したい テーブル と、更新元の テーブル を追加します。
  3. 更新する フィールド を指定します。
  4. 更新元テーブルの フィールド を指定します。

更新クエリの実行方法

更新クエリを実行するには、クエリデザイナでクエリを作成した後、クエリを実行 ボタンをクリックします。更新クエリを実行する前に、バックアップ を取ることをお勧めします。 更新クエリの実行手順は以下の通りです。

  1. クエリデザイナ でクエリを作成します。
  2. クエリを実行 ボタンをクリックします。
  3. 更新内容を確認します。

更新クエリの注意点

更新クエリを実行する際には、注意が必要です。更新クエリは、データベース内のデータを直接更新するため、誤った更新クエリを実行すると、データが破損する可能性があります。 更新クエリの注意点は以下の通りです。

  1. バックアップ を取ることをお勧めします。
  2. 更新クエリを実行する前に、テスト を行います。
  3. 更新内容 を確認します。

更新クエリの応用例

更新クエリは、さまざまな場面で使用できます。たとえば、在庫管理 システムでは、在庫テーブルの在庫数を更新するために更新クエリを使用できます。 更新クエリの応用例は以下の通りです。

  1. 在庫管理 システムでの在庫数の更新。
  2. 顧客管理 システムでの顧客情報の更新。
  3. 注文管理 システムでの注文ステータスの更新。

クエリを全て更新するにはどうすればいいですか?

fspic140603

クエリを全て更新するには、データベース管理システム(DBMS)や使用しているアプリケーションの機能を利用する必要があります。一般的には、SQLコマンドや専用の更新ツールを使用してクエリを更新します。

SQLコマンドを使用したクエリの更新

SQLコマンドを使用することで、データベース内のクエリを直接更新できます。具体的には、`ALTER TABLE`文や`UPDATE`文を使用して、クエリの定義を変更できます。以下は、SQLコマンドを使用する際の主な手順です:

  1. クエリの定義を確認し、変更内容を決定する
  2. `ALTER TABLE`文や`UPDATE`文を使用して、クエリを更新する
  3. 変更内容を検証し、必要に応じて修正する

アプリケーションの機能を使用したクエリの更新

多くのアプリケーションでは、クエリを更新するためのグラフィカルユーザーインターフェイス(GUI)を提供しています。これらの機能を使用することで、SQLコマンドの知識がなくてもクエリを更新できます。以下は、アプリケーションの機能を使用する際の主な手順です:

  1. クエリエディタを開き、更新するクエリを選択する
  2. クエリの定義を変更し、保存する
  3. 変更内容をテストし、必要に応じて修正する

クエリ更新時の注意事項

クエリを更新する際には、データの整合性やパフォーマンスに影響がないことを確認する必要があります。また、更新内容が他のクエリやアプリケーションの機能に影響を与えないことを確認することも重要です。以下は、クエリ更新時の主な注意事項です:

  1. データ型や制約の変更に注意する
  2. クエリの最適化を行い、パフォーマンスを維持する
  3. 更新内容をドキュメント化し、他の開発者と共有する

アクセスのクエリとテーブルの違いは何ですか?

00211

アクセスのクエリとテーブルの違いは、データベースにおけるデータの取得と格納の方法にあります。クエリは、データベースから特定のデータを取得するためのSQL文であり、テーブルは、データを格納するための構造化されたデータの集合です。

クエリの基本的な機能

クエリは、データベースから必要なデータを取得するために使用されます。クエリを使用することで、データのフィルタリング、ソート、集計などの処理を行うことができます。以下は、クエリの主な機能です。

  1. データの抽出:クエリを使用して、テーブルから必要なデータのみを抽出できます。
  2. データの操作:クエリを使用して、データの更新、挿入、削除などの操作を行うことができます。
  3. データの分析:クエリを使用して、データの集計や統計などの分析を行うことができます。

テーブルの基本的な構造

テーブルは、データを格納するための構造化されたデータの集合です。テーブルは、行と列で構成されており、各行はレコードと呼ばれ、各列はフィールドと呼ばれます。以下は、テーブルの主な特徴です。

  1. データの格納:テーブルは、データを格納するための構造化されたデータの集合です。
  2. データの定義:テーブルのスキーマを定義することで、データの構造を決定できます。
  3. データの管理:テーブルを使用して、データの追加、更新、削除などの管理を行うことができます。

クエリとテーブルの関係

クエリとテーブルは密接に関係しています。クエリは、テーブルからデータを取得するために使用され、テーブルの構造は、クエリの作成に影響します。以下は、クエリとテーブルの関係です。

  1. クエリの作成:テーブルの構造に基づいて、クエリを作成します。
  2. データの取得:クエリを使用して、テーブルから必要なデータを取得します。
  3. データの操作:クエリを使用して、テーブルのデータを操作できます。

Accessのテーブルの一括更新方法は?

query 05

Accessのテーブルの一括更新方法については、クエリを使用することが一般的です。具体的には、更新クエリを作成して、テーブル内のデータを一括で更新することができます。

更新クエリの作成方法

更新クエリを作成するには、まずクエリデザイナを開き、更新対象のテーブルを選択します。次に、更新するフィールドを指定し、更新行に新しい値を入力します。

  1. 更新クエリのタイプを選択します。
  2. 更新対象のフィールドを指定します。
  3. 条件を指定して、更新するレコードを絞り込みます。

一括更新の実行

更新クエリを作成したら、クエリを実行することで、一括更新が実行されます。実行前に、バックアップを取ることをお勧めします。また、更新クエリの影響を受けるレコード数を確認することも重要です。

  1. クエリを保存して、再利用できるようにします。
  2. 実行ボタンをクリックして、一括更新を実行します。
  3. ログを確認して、更新結果を検証します。

一括更新の注意点

一括更新を実行する際には、データの整合性や制約に注意する必要があります。また、トランザクションを使用して、更新処理を管理することもできます。

  1. 制約やトリガーの影響を確認します。
  2. データ型やフォーマットの変更に注意します。
  3. バックアップとリストアの手順を確認します。

Accessで更新クエリを実行するとどうなる?

query 03

Accessで更新クエリを実行すると、指定された条件に基づいてテーブル内のデータが一括更新されます。更新クエリは、特定のフィールドの値を変更したり、複数のレコードを一度に更新したりする場合に便利です。

更新クエリの基本的な動作

更新クエリを実行すると、Accessは指定された条件に一致するレコードを検索し、指定されたフィールドの値を新しい値に更新します。更新クエリは、データの整合性を保つために、関連するテーブル間のリレーションシップを考慮して設計する必要があります。
以下の点に注意する必要があります。

  1. 更新クエリを実行する前に、必ずバックアップを作成してください。
  2. 更新クエリの条件を慎重に指定し、意図しないレコードが更新されないようにします。
  3. 更新クエリの結果を確認するために、テスト実行を行うことをお勧めします。

更新クエリの使用例

更新クエリは、さまざまなシナリオで使用できます。たとえば、特定の顧客カテゴリのレコードを更新して、新しい割引率を適用することができます。また、在庫管理システムで、特定の商品カテゴリの在庫数を一括更新することもできます。
更新クエリの使用例としては、次のようなものがあります。

  1. 価格の変更:特定の商品カテゴリの価格を一括更新する。
  2. ステータスの更新:注文のステータスを「未処理」から「処理済み」に更新する。
  3. データの修正:誤ったデータを修正するために、特定のフィールドの値を更新する。

更新クエリの注意点

更新クエリを実行する際には、いくつかの注意点があります。まず、更新クエリは元に戻すことができないため、実行前に必ずバックアップを作成する必要があります。また、更新クエリの条件を慎重に指定し、意図しないレコードが更新されないようにする必要があります。
更新クエリの注意点としては、次のようなものがあります。

  1. 更新クエリは慎重に設計する必要があります。
  2. テスト実行を行って、更新クエリの結果を確認します。
  3. 更新クエリを実行する前に、関連するテーブルをロックする必要があります。

詳細情報

ACCESSの更新クエリとは何ですか?

ACCESSの更新クエリは、データベース内の既存のデータを一括で更新するためのクエリです。このクエリを使用することで、特定の条件を満たすレコードのデータを簡単に変更できます。たとえば、顧客の住所を変更する場合や、在庫の数量を更新する場合などに役立ちます。更新クエリは、SQL文を使用して記述され、ACCESSのクエリデザイナを使用して視覚的に作成することもできます。

他のテーブルのデータを用いて更新クエリを作成する方法は?

他のテーブルのデータを用いて更新クエリを作成するには、まずテーブル間の関連付けが必要です。ACCESSでは、クエリデザイナで複数のテーブルを追加し、必要なフィールドを関連付けることで、他のテーブルのデータを使用して更新を行うことができます。たとえば、注文テーブルと顧客テーブルのデータを関連付けて、顧客の情報を更新することができます。このとき、JOIN句を使用してテーブルの関連付けを行います。

更新クエリの実行前に注意すべき点は何ですか?

更新クエリを実行する前に、バックアップを取ることが重要です。更新クエリは、データベース内のデータを直接変更するため、誤った操作によってデータが失われたり、破損したりする可能性があります。また、更新クエリのテストを実行して、意図した通りに動作することを確認することも大切です。これにより、データの不整合や予期しない変更を防ぐことができます。

更新クエリの実行後にデータを確認する方法は?

更新クエリの実行後には、データの確認が不可欠です。更新されたデータを検証するために、関連するテーブルを開いてデータをチェックします。また、SELECTクエリを作成して、更新されたデータを抽出し、結果を確認することもできます。これにより、更新クエリが正しく動作したことを確認し、データの正確性を保つことができます。さらに、必要に応じて、更新クエリをログに記録しておくことも有効です。

コメントを残す

メールアドレスが公開されることはありません。 が付いている欄は必須項目です